1930s Home Restoration Dream

Nestled beneath mature trees and wrapped in timeless Southern charm, this 1930s brick home offers a rare chance to revive a true architectural treasure. Priced at just $39,000, it features three bedrooms, three bathrooms, and nearly 3,000 square feet of space—an extraordinary opportunity for anyone who values craftsmanship, history, and the satisfaction of restoration.

From the moment you arrive, the home’s character is unmistakable. The sweeping arched porch, supported by sturdy brick columns, sets a tone of quality rarely found today. Its distinctive roofline and remarkably preserved brickwork add to the home’s charm, while curved vintage windows promise soft natural light once restored.

Inside, the generous layout enhances its historic appeal. High ceilings, wide hallways, and oversized windows create an airy, inviting atmosphere. With nearly 2,900 square feet, the home offers ample room for transformation, whether through refinished hardwood floors, revived trim, or restored archways that reconnect the interior with its former elegance.

The three bedrooms and three full bathrooms provide flexibility. Whether envisioned as a family home, rental property, or restored showpiece, each space offers potential for modern upgrades that still honor the home’s original style. Large living and dining areas allow for either open-concept reimagining or preservation of traditional layout.
